MELO MEDEROS, Zenia Amparo et al. Lung nodules image characterization at the Academic General Hospital Vladimir I. Lenin, Holguín, Cuba. ccm [online]. 2019, vol.23, n.3, pp. 718-738.  Epub 01-Set-2019. ISSN 1560-4381.

Introduction:

lung cancer is one of the first death causes, in Cuba. They appear in X-rays as rounded opacities less than 3 cm. Procedures are necessary to determine their benign or malign nature. Images characteristic research with computerized X-rays, recently installed in the institution are objectives of the Ministry of Public Health in Cuba.

Objective:

to characterize incidental lung nodules in patients assisted at the Academic General Hospital Vladimir I. Lenin, Holguín, Cuba, from July to September 2017.

Method:

a retrospective observational study based on 42 patients sample, with computerized X-rays incidental nodules, older than 35 without congestive vascular affection. Ethical principles were fulfilled.

Results:

nodules were predominant in patients between 61 and 79 years old (50%) and the amount of male doubled feminine patients. The right lung was the most affected (64%), in the higher field (41%) in the peripheral area (60%) and in all locations size was less than 6 mm.

The subsolid nodules (n=64) were presented as grinding glass (67%), those in solid parts (33%), speculations in a 25%. About 40.4% of patients classified as high risk, 21.4% low risk and 38.1% intermediate risk.

Conclusions:

nodules were identified by computerized X-rays nodules as very small and characterized according to recent imagenological classification, clinical aspects and epidemiological antecedents, including smoking habit allowed risk cancer contrast in lung nodule incidental bearer.
